Bonne pratique pour serveur Apache et virtual host
Bonjour à tous,
je me suis lancé dans l'installation et la configuration d'un serveur web sous Cent OS 7, jusqu'ici tout va bien.
Récemment, j'ai décidé de créer des sous-domaines à mon serveur web, j'ai suivi la configuration suivante :
- pour chaque sous-domaine, j'ai créé un fichier de configuration dans /etc/httpd/sites-available
- créer un lien symbolique pour chaque sous-domaine valide dans /etc/httpd/sites-enabled
Je ne sais pas si cette configuration est la meilleur, mais d'après ce que j'ai vu/lu sur le web cela semblait une bonne pratique.
Toutefois j'ai une question, qui va peut-être vous paraître bête, mais pour laquelle je n'ai pas réussi à trouver de réponse claire :
Où doit-on mettre la configuration de notre serveur principal ?
dans /etc/httpd/conf/httpd.conf ou /etc/httpd/conf.d/ssl.conf ou bien dans un fichier de configuration dans /etc/httpd/site-available ?
Pour résumer :
- j'ai mon domaine : exemple.com,
- mes sous-domaine sousdomain1.exemple.com, sousdomaine2.exemple.com
Avec les configurations :
- domaine exemple.com dans /etc/httpd/conf.d/ssl.conf
- sous-domaine : 1 fichier par sous-domaine dans /etc/httpd/site-available
En espérant être assez clair :D, merci pour votre retour.
Mickaël.
Merci pour votre retour